Lead Network Security Engineer
Posted 20 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
Key Responsibilities:
- Design, implement, and maintain enterprise-level network security architectures, including firewalls, VPNs, intrusion detection/prevention systems, and access control mechanisms.
- Develop and enforce network security policies, standards, and procedures.
- Monitor network traffic for security breaches, anomalies, and potential threats, and respond effectively to incidents.
- Conduct regular security assessments, vulnerability scans, and penetration tests to identify and mitigate risks.
- Manage and optimize security technologies to ensure their effectiveness and efficiency.
- Lead security incident response efforts, including investigation, containment, eradication, and recovery.
- Collaborate with IT infrastructure teams to ensure secure network configurations and implementations.
- Provide technical leadership and mentorship to junior security engineers.
- Stay abreast of the latest cybersecurity threats, vulnerabilities, and technologies, and recommend appropriate countermeasures.
- Develop and deliver security awareness training to employees.
- Ensure compliance with relevant security regulations and standards.

Lead Network Security Architect - Remote
Posted 20 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
Responsibilities:
- Design and architect secure network solutions, including firewalls, intrusion detection/prevention systems, VPNs, and other security controls.
- Develop and enforce network security policies, standards, and procedures across the organization.
- Lead security assessments, vulnerability testing, and penetration testing initiatives.
- Respond to security incidents, conduct forensic investigations, and implement remediation measures.
- Collaborate with IT operations and development teams to integrate security into the entire system development lifecycle.
- Evaluate and recommend new security technologies and solutions to enhance network defenses.
- Provide technical leadership and mentorship to junior security engineers.
- Develop and deliver security awareness training to employees.
- Ensure compliance with relevant industry regulations and standards.
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Cybersecurity, Information Technology, or a related field. Master's degree or equivalent experience preferred.
- Minimum of 10 years of progressive experience in network security, with at least 5 years in an architectural or lead role.
- In-depth knowledge of TCP/IP, routing protocols (BGP, OSPF), and network security principles.
- Hands-on experience with enterprise-grade security solutions such as Palo Alto, Cisco, Fortinet, Check Point, etc.
- Proficiency in scripting languages (Python, Bash) for automation is highly desirable.
- Strong understanding of cloud security (AWS, Azure, GCP) and modern network architectures.
-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making abilities.
-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to articulate complex technical concepts to both technical and non-technical audiences.
- Relevant security certifications (CISSP, CCIE Security, CISM) are a strong asset.
- Proven ability to work autonomously and manage complex projects in a fully remote setting.
Lead Cybersecurity Engineer - Cloud Security
Posted 20 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
Key Responsibilities:
- Design, implement, and manage security solutions for cloud environments (AWS, Azure, GCP).
- Develop and enforce cloud security policies, standards, and procedures.
- Conduct regular vulnerability assessments and penetration testing to identify and remediate security weaknesses.
- Monitor cloud infrastructure for security threats and respond effectively to security incidents and breaches.
- Implement and manage security tools such as firewalls, IDS/IPS, SIEM, and endpoint detection and response (EDR) solutions.
- Collaborate with development and operations teams to integrate security into the CI/CD pipeline (DevSecOps).
- Ensure compliance with relevant security regulations and industry best practices.
- Develop and deliver security awareness training to employees.
- Stay abreast of the latest cybersecurity threats, trends, and technologies.
- Mentor junior security team members and provide technical guidance.
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Security, or a related field. Advanced certifications (e.g., CISSP, CCSP, AWS Security Specialty) are highly desirable.
- Minimum of 6 years of experience in cybersecurity, with at least 3 years focused on cloud security.
- Proven experience securing major c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P).
- Strong understanding of network security, application security, and data security principles.
- Experience with scripting languages (e.g., Python, Bash) for automation.
- Familiarity with security frameworks like NIST, ISO 27001, and SOC 2.
-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
- Ability to work effectively in both team and independent settings.
